Tom assists in the firm's representation of clients in land use, redevelopment, transactional real estate, and condominium and planned real estate matters. His work includes the drafting of redevelopment and financial agreements, including PILOT agreement applications, as well as land use and zoning applications, settlement agreements, and contractor agreements.

In the area of planned real estate development, he has provided support related to the registration of developments with the New Jersey Department of Community Affairs, including the preparation of public offering statements, declarations, master deeds, and other governing documents.

As a summer associate and intern at the firm and elsewhere, Tom gained valuable experience by working closely with partners and other attorneys, including significant research on land use, redevelopment, and municipal governance matters.
